
AC Milan coach Stefano Pioli was left delighted after their 2-0 win against Atalanta.
The result leaves Milan two points clear at the top of the table.
Pioli said: “I had to salute the fans, it was our last home game of the season, they've been inspiring us with their passion for a year, now we've got another week and mustn't change anything, we retain the usual concentration and calm.
“Atalanta are a very strong team and created a lot of problems, but we did very well in defence and allowed them very few scoring opportunities. We also did well trying to find the solution to create those spaces, players going back and forth, wide and closer to the centre.
“All the previous games taught us that we have what it takes in terms of determination, belief and courage. Those comeback wins over Lazio and Verona gave us more belief, that takes away some of the anxiety.
“The lads know we have strengths and weaknesses, we must try to make the most of our strengths."
Pioli added: “In all honesty, the last few weeks have been very normal, because I see the attitude of my players, they are smiling, joking, determined and focused when they arrive at the training ground every day. I don't need to worry, because I see that focus.
“We had 10,000 fans waiting for us as we drove through on the bus, that obviously fired everyone up. Now I expect another week like this."
